If you want AdSense, you have to play by their rules.  You might have luck creating another gmail account and setting up AdSense on another computer (IP) and using a different domain name, but other than that - you will not get your AdSense account back.  They are pretty serious about AdSense and they treat their program as a privilege, which I agree with.

I think right now the SECOND best option out there may be Media.net [nofollow].

I have both AdSense and Media.net.  I make about 30% of the revenue of AdSense on Media.net.  It's not much, but better than nothing.

Sorry right now nothing beats AdSense unless you get into Ad partnerships.
